Understanding How AI Image Portraits Work

At its core, “ai image portrait maker” technology relies on machine learning models, predominantly Generative Adversarial Networks GANs and Diffusion Models.

  • Generative Adversarial Networks GANs: Imagine two AIs battling it out. One, the generator, creates images, trying to fool the other, the discriminator, into thinking they’re real. The discriminator tries to spot the fakes. Through this iterative process, the generator gets incredibly good at creating convincing images. In portraits, this means generating incredibly lifelike or stylistically coherent faces.
  • Diffusion Models: These models work by progressively adding noise to an image until it’s just random pixels, then learning to reverse that process, gradually removing the noise to reconstruct the original image or create new ones based on prompts. This approach has led to stunningly realistic and highly controllable “ai image portrait” outputs, allowing users to guide the generation with specific textual descriptions.
  • Training Data: Both types of models are trained on colossal datasets of images—think millions, even billions, of photographs and artworks. This vast exposure allows them to learn patterns, facial structures, lighting, and artistic styles, which they then use to generate new content. For example, a model trained on classical portraiture can generate an “ai image portrait” resembling a Rembrandt painting. Statistics show that some of the largest image datasets used for AI training, like LAION-5B, contain over 5 billion image-text pairs, providing an unprecedented reservoir of visual information for AI to learn from.

Generative Adversarial Networks GANs Explained

GANs are a foundational technology for many “ai image photo generator” applications.

They consist of two neural networks, a generator and a discriminator, locked in a perpetual game of cat and mouse.

  • The Generator’s Role: The generator’s job is to create new data instances that resemble the training data. For “ai image portrait,” it tries to produce realistic-looking faces or transform existing ones into a desired style.
  • The Discriminator’s Role: The discriminator’s task is to distinguish between real data and data generated by the generator. It acts as a critic, providing feedback to the generator.
  • The Adversarial Process: Over millions of iterations, the generator learns to produce increasingly convincing outputs, while the discriminator becomes better at spotting fakes. This adversarial training pushes both networks to improve, resulting in remarkably high-quality “ai image portrait” outputs. For example, StyleGAN, a prominent GAN architecture, has been instrumental in generating hyper-realistic human faces that are almost indistinguishable from real photographs.

Diffusion Models and Their Impact on Portrait Generation

While GANs have been revolutionary, Diffusion Models have recently emerged as a powerful alternative, particularly for their ability to generate highly detailed and coherent images from text prompts. Corel draw 2022 free download

  • How They Work: Diffusion models work by gradually adding random noise to an image forward diffusion process until it’s pure noise. Then, they learn to reverse this process reverse diffusion process, effectively “denoising” the image to generate a new one. This iterative refinement allows for exceptional control over the generated “ai image portrait.”
  • Text-to-Image Generation: One of the most exciting applications is their proficiency in text-to-image generation. Users can type descriptions like “a portrait of a wise old man with a flowing beard, in the style of a classical oil painting,” and the diffusion model will attempt to render that vision as an “ai image portrait.” This capability makes them powerful “ai portrait image creator” tools.
  • Quality and Detail: Diffusion models often produce images with a higher level of detail and realism than many GANs, especially for complex scenes and nuanced textures, making them ideal for high-fidelity “ai image portrait” creation. Recent research indicates that diffusion models can achieve superior perceptual quality and diversity compared to GANs in many image generation tasks.

Bias in AI Models

One of the most significant challenges stems from the training data used to develop these AI models.

  • Dataset Bias: AI models learn from the data they are fed. If the dataset predominantly features certain demographics, ethnicities, or body types, the “ai image portrait generator” may struggle to accurately or fairly represent underrepresented groups. This can lead to skewed or stereotypical outputs. A study by the AI Now Institute revealed that many large public datasets used for facial recognition and generation are disproportionately skewed towards lighter-skinned individuals, leading to performance disparities.
  • Stereotype Reinforcement: Unchecked, AI can inadvertently perpetuate or even amplify societal biases and stereotypes present in the training data. For instance, an “ai image photo” generated for a “leader” might consistently produce images of men in business suits, reinforcing gender or professional stereotypes.
  • Mitigation Efforts: Researchers are actively working on curating more diverse and balanced datasets and developing algorithms that can identify and correct biases. However, this remains an ongoing and complex challenge.

Artifacts and Uncanny Valley

Despite remarkable progress, AI-generated images, especially portraits, can still exhibit peculiar imperfections.

  • Uncanny Valley Effect: This psychological phenomenon describes the unsettling feeling people get when seeing something that is almost human but not quite. While “ai image portrait” can be incredibly realistic, subtle distortions in eyes, hands, or facial symmetry can trigger this “uncanny valley” effect, making the image feel creepy or unnatural.
  • Generation Artifacts: AI models can sometimes produce visual anomalies or “artifacts” – strange distortions, mismatched elements, or nonsensical details that betray their artificial origin. This is particularly noticeable in complex areas like fingers, teeth, or hair. For example, some early “ai image portrait maker” tools were notorious for generating portraits with distorted or extra fingers.
  • Inconsistency and Coherence: Maintaining consistency in style or character across multiple generated images can be challenging. An “ai portrait image creator” might produce one stunning image but struggle to replicate the exact same character with different expressions or poses consistently.
